Get started19 Dennyview Road is a detached house in Abbots Leigh, Bristol, Bristol (BS8 3RD). It has a recorded floor area of 174 m² (around 1873 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1930-1949 and council tax band F. The latest certificate (October 2012) shows an E (score 49), well below the UK norm with real room to improve. The recommended improvements would lift it to C (score 76), a 2-band jump. Main heating runs on oil. The latest certificate is from October 2012, so improvements made since then won't be reflected.
Sale prices here have outpaced England HPI: 9.2%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£876,000 is 40.2% above the 2014 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£334/sq ft) was about 86.4% above the typical sold price in the postcode. 7 planning records sit against the property, 4 approved, 2 refused. Past consents include an extension,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. 12 years since the last transfer (January 2014).
